Now, Brinton is facing two separate charges of stealing luggage at an airport.

As reported by the New York Post

“A Biden administration Energy Department official who allegedly stole a woman’s suitcase from a Minneapolis airport in September has been accused of another luggage heist at a Las Vegas airport.

A felony warrant on grand larceny charges was issued on Thursday for Sam Brinton, the deputy assistant secretary for spent fuel and waste disposition at the Department of Energy’s Office of Nuclear Energy, The Post can confirm.

Brinton, who made history as one of the federal government’s first gender-fluid officials, allegedly stole luggage from another traveler at Harry Reid International Airport in Vegas on an unknown date, according to the outlet.”

What is not as well-known about Brinton is that he famously testified about the terrible “conversion therapy” abuse he was allegedly subjected to as a boy.

So powerful was his testimony that is was used to bolster legal efforts to prevent people with unwanted same-sex attraction from getting professional help.

As reported on Yahoo! Life in September 2019, 

“The Trevor Project’s Sam Brinton survived conversion therapy—now they're fighting to ban the practice. Brinton admitted his attraction to men to his father at a young age, and said he then became extremely physically abusive. His parents eventually sent him to undergo conversion therapy. Conversion therapy is a practice that attempts to change a person’s sexual orientation or gender identity. The controversial practice employs a variety of techniques, including talk therapy, inducing nausea, vomiting, or paralysis; electric shocks, and hypnosis.”

Putting aside the caricatured and misleading description of “conversion therapy,” a term used by critics not by practitioners (for the truth afbout “conversion therapy,” recently published in the Archives of Sexual Behavior,see here), even radical LGBTQ+ activists questioned the veracity of Brinton’s story, finding it too good to be true.

In the words of Wayne Besen, himself a leading opponent of any efforts to reduce or reverse unwanted same-sex attractions, leading “organizations, such as the Trevor Project and the National Center for Lesbian Rights (NCLR), ignored clear warning signs and incontrovertible evidence because Brinton provided these groups with a seemingly perfect ex-gay survivor story to expose horrific conversion therapy practices and ideology.” (Besen, in keeping with LGBT orthodoxy, refers to Brinton as “they” rather than “he,” since Brinton’s “preferred gender pronouns” are “they, them, theirs” rather than “he, him, his.” Besen also slams ex-gay and ex-trans individuals by name in his article, in keeping with his agenda.)

The lies of Brinton’s testimony was also pointed out on the Sam Brinton Hoax website. (The information on this website is quite troubling in light of the fact Brinton is a high-ranking official in our government.)

And a practicing psychiatrist informed a group of conservative activists and medical professionals in a December 7 email that, “I have talked to Sam Brinton's mother and she confirms that it is all a fabrication. Yes he was taken to therapy as a teen but not for gayness but for another issue and he received only appropriate talk therapy.”

If, in fact, Brinton was lying about his past as well, this is yet another reason to pray for him.
